Kosy helps companies create and sustain an informal remote company culture that goes beyond current productivity tools such as Slack, Teams and Zoom. In Kosy, users interact in various types of rooms with video and audio capabilities. Room types include co-working spaces, water cooler, happy hour, focus, brainstorm, gaming many more in the roadmap. Users can jump between rooms and see in real-time what their colleagues are up to.
